Cancer therapies are various modes of treatment, such as surgery, radiation therapy, and chemotherapy that are administered to cancer patients.
However, cancer treatments can pose several challenges, as therapies used to kill cancer cells are generally also toxic to normal cells. Moreover, cancer cells mutate rapidly and can develop resistance to chemical agents or radiation therapy. Besides, all types of cancer cells may not respond to the same therapy. Osteoclasts are cells responsible for bone resorption and remodeling. They originate from hematopoietic progenitor cells present in the bone marrow. Numerous progenitor cells fuse to form multinucleated cells, each with 10-20 nuclei. A single osteoclast has a diameter of 150 to 200 µM. These cells have ruffled borders that break down the underlying bone tissue and release minerals such as calcium into the blood in bone resorption. 背景情况:

  • 狗骨肉瘤 (OSA) 的治疗方法在过去二十年里基本没有变化.
  • 目前的标准护理依赖于截肢和基于的化疗.
  • 需要改善犬类OSA的治疗策略和结果.

研究的目的:

  • 审查最近在犬骨髓瘤的临床护理方面的进展.
  • 突出新兴的诊断和治疗创新.
  • 讨论这些进展对治疗和预后的潜在影响.

主要方法:

  • 基因组研究确定了狗和人类OSA之间的共同遗传异常.
  • 多维成像技术用于分期和预后.
  • 对新型治疗方法的审查,包括节约四肢手术,立体性身体放射治疗,废除疗法 (微波废除,组织缩),免疫疗法 (细胞疗法,免疫检查点抑制) 和放射性药物.

主要成果:

  • 基因组研究揭示了狗和人类OSA的共同遗传驱动因素.
  • 先进的成像提高了诊断准确性和预后评估.
  • 新兴疗法显示出增强疼痛控制,生存和向治疗的前景.
  • 创新提供了传统截肢和化疗的替代方案.

结论:

  • 最近的科学和技术进步正在改变狗骨髓瘤治疗.
  • 这些创新具有改善治疗疗效和患者预后的巨大潜力.
  • 对比性瘤学研究继续推动人类和犬类OSA的进展.
